NURS 520 Advanced Pathophysiology
Credit Hours
3.00
Degree Level
Graduate
Understanding of normal system-focused advanced physiology is applied to pathologic disease process to form a firm foundation for clinical assessment, decision making and clinical management. Includes in-depth study of cell structure and function as a foundation to understanding physiologic as well as pathophysiologic process. An in-depth examination of normal disease process including analysis of common disease, incidence, etiology, manifestation, and prognosis is included. Throughout the course, emphasis is placed on the student’s ability to analyze and discuss changes in the normal physiologic function that occurs with the disease process.
